Foundation Overview

Based in San Rafael, CA, Dino J Ghilotti Foundation has awarded 69 grants totaling $591,000 to organizations in California. Individual grants range from $2,000 to $30,000, with a median award of $7,500.

Geographic Focus
California

100% of all grants are concentrated in California, demonstrating highly focused geographic giving. This foundation prioritizes deep community impact in its primary service area. Within California, funding concentrates in San Rafael (51%), Novato (17%), San Anselmo (10%).

Application Status
According to its most recent IRS Form 990-PF filing, this foundation only funds pre-selected organizations and does not accept unsolicited grant applications - consider whether you have an existing connection before reaching out.
